Introduction

The main purpose of this scheme is to certify the genetic authenticity and identity of the rice seed varieties produced. This scheme is provided for the production of legal paddy seeds by appointed producers only. Lots of seeds certified to meet the standards will be labeled quality certification blue for legal rice seeds and light purple for registered rice seeds.

Classification of Seed Categories in the Process of Legal Paddy Seed Production

  • Basic Seeds  : Basic seeds are progeny from the cultivation of breed seeds whose production is controlled according to certain procedures to ensure the level of genetic purity and certified to meet the set standards. Basic seeds are produced by the Malaysian Agricultural Research and Development Institute (MARDI).
  • Registered Seeds  : Registered seeds are progeny from the cultivation of basic seeds whose production is controlled according to certain procedures to ensure the level of genetic authenticity and certified to meet the standards set under the Department of Agriculture Malaysia Standards (SJPM - 2009).
  • Legitimate Seeds  : Legitimate seeds are progeny from the cultivation of registered seeds whose production is controlled according to the procedures of the Paddy Seed Certification Scheme and Standards of the Department of Agriculture Malaysia (SJPM - 2009) to ensure the level of genetic authenticity and certified to meet the set standards.

Important Elements In The Production Of Legal Paddy Seeds

  • Nurseries and seed farms  : Meet the distance of isolation and site perfection.
  • Certified seed category source  : Planting from a legitimate source. Proof of seed source is required.
  • Farm inspection  : Farm inspection is carried out in four stages, namely pre-planting, pruning, flowering and pre-harvest. It aims to ensure that the varieties grown according to the characteristics of the varieties and meet the farm standards as stipulated in the Standards document of the Department of Agriculture Malaysia SJPM - 2009.
  • Inspection of paddy seed processing plant  : Paddy seed processing plant must be clean and free from any contamination or mixing of varieties.
  • Seed quality test  : Three types of tests conducted, namely physical authenticity test, humidity and germination aims to determine whether the paddy seeds that have been processed meet the minimum standards of seeds as stipulated in the Department of Agriculture Malaysia SJPM - 2009 Standard document.
  • Store and stock inspection  : Only certified rice seeds are offered for sale. Lots of rice seeds must be in good condition, orderly and easy to detect.
  • Quality certification label  : Seed lots that meet the standard have a set of seed quality certification labels.
